What is Nescafe?
Nescafe is a brand of instant coffee made by Nestlé. Established in the 1930s, Nescafe revolutionized the way people consume coffee, offering a quick and easy solution for coffee lovers. The brand encompasses a range of products, including classic instant coffee, decaf, and specialty flavored options.
Types of Nescafe Coffee
Understanding the different types of Nescafe coffee can help you choose the right product for your needs. Here’s a brief breakdown:
- Nescafe Classic: The original instant coffee blend that offers a rich and full-bodied flavor.
- Nescafe Gold: A premium version that delivers a smoother, more refined taste.
- Nescafe Decaf: Perfect for those avoiding caffeine but still wanting to enjoy coffee’s taste.
- Nescafe 3-in-1: A convenient mix of coffee, sugar, and cream that needs no additional ingredients.
- Nescafe Ready-to-Drink: Pre-packaged coffee drinks that come in various flavors.
Choosing the right type of Nescafe depends on your flavor preference and how quickly you need your caffeine fix.
Preparing Nescafe: Step-by-Step Instructions
Making Nescafe coffee is simple and takes just a few minutes. Here, we’ll guide you through creating the perfect cup of Nescafe using various methods.
Standard Preparation Method
For beginners, the standard method is the easiest way to prepare Nescafe coffee. Here’s what you need to do:
Ingredients:
- 1-2 teaspoons of Nescafe (adjust according to taste)
- Hot water (not boiling)
- Optional: Sugar, milk, or creamer (to taste)
Instructions:
- Boil water and let it cool for about 30 seconds. This prevents the coffee from becoming bitter.
- In a cup, add 1-2 teaspoons of Nescafe coffee granules.
- Pour in the hot water, filling the cup to your preferred level.
- Stir well until the coffee granules are completely dissolved.
- Add sugar, milk, or creamer as desired. Stir again and enjoy your cup of Nescafe!
Making Iced Nescafe
On a warm day, iced Nescafe is a refreshing and energizing option. Follow these simple steps to create delicious iced coffee.
Ingredients:
- 1-2 teaspoons of Nescafe
- Hot water
- Ice cubes
- Milk or non-dairy alternatives (optional)
Instructions:
- Prepare the Nescafe coffee using the standard method—adding hot water to Nescafe granules.
- Let the coffee cool to room temperature.
- Fill a glass with ice cubes.
- Pour the cooled Nescafe over the ice and add milk or your preferred alternative if desired.
- Stir and enjoy your refreshing iced Nescafe coffee!

Nescafe Coffee Cake
For a sweet treat, try your hand at baking a Nescafe coffee cake.
Ingredients:
Ingredient | Quantity |
---|---|
All-purpose flour | 2 cups |
Sugar | 1 cup |
Baking powder | 2 teaspoons |
Nescafe | 2 tablespoons |
Eggs | 2 |
Milk | 1 cup |
Butter (melted) | 1/2 cup |
Vanilla extract | 1 teaspoon |
Instructions:
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a bowl, mix flour, sugar, baking powder, and Nescafe.
- In another bowl, combine eggs, milk, melted butter, and vanilla extract.
-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and mix until well combined.
- Pour the batter into a greased baking pan and bake for about 30-35 minutes or until golden brown.
- Let it cool, slice, and serve with a cup of Nescafe.

How do I prepare the perfect cup of Nescafe?
To prepare the perfect cup of Nescafe, start with the right ratio of coffee to water. A general guideline is to use one to two teaspoons of Nescafe per cup of hot water (about 6-8 ounces). Depending on your personal taste preference, you may want to adjust the amount to make it stronger or milder.
Next, heat your water to just below boiling, around 190-205°F (88-96°C), as boiling water can scorch the coffee and lead to a bitter taste. Stir the Nescafe granules into the hot water until completely dissolved, and then customize your drink with milk, sugar, or other flavorings as desired for a truly personalized experience.
Can I use cold water to make Nescafe?
Yes, you can use cold water to make Nescafe, although it may take a bit longer for the granules to dissolve completely. Cold Nescafe is often enjoyed as iced coffee, making it a refreshing choice, especially in warmer weather. To prepare cold Nescafe, add the desired amount of coffee granules to a glass filled with cold water and stir well.
Alternatively, you can opt to mix your Nescafe with milk or even cold brew to create unique iced coffee recipes. Just be sure to allow ample mixing time to ensure that the granules dissolve properly, contributing to a smooth and flavorful iced beverage.

Is Nescafe gluten-free and safe for those with dietary restrictions?
Yes, Nescafe is generally considered gluten-free, making it safe for individuals with gluten sensitivities or celiac disease. However, it’s always a good practice to check the label for any specific allergen information, as cross-contamination can sometimes occur during manufacturing processes.
For those with other dietary restrictions, such as lactose intolerance or vegan preferences, Nescafe is a versatile choice. You can easily customize your cup by using plant-based milk alternatives or avoiding sweeteners that do not meet your dietary needs. Always read the ingredients in any specific blends or flavored options to ensure they align with your diet.
